Is Nutrition & Female Fertility Connected?
There is a great deal of complexity involved when considering the effects of nutrition on female reproductive health. However, a multitude of studies suggests that diet quality, particularly the ingestion of processed foods, is a key modifiable risk factor that may be responsible for contributing to lower pregnancy and increased miscarriage rates.
